KatadataOTO – The continuation of electric motorcycle subsidies is still unclear. This is said to be one of the main obstacles to the sale of environmentally friendly two-wheeled vehicles.

Currently, the program for four-wheeled vehicles, both pure electric and hybrid, is still ongoing.

For electric cars, there is a 10 percent VAT (Value Added Tax) discount. Meanwhile, a smaller discount of three percent applies to hybrid cars.

The scheme for electric motorcycles is slightly different. A direct discount of around Rp 7 million is applied to the price.

Periklindo (Indonesian Electric Vehicle Industry Association) highlights the negative impact of the uncertainty surrounding electric motorcycle subsidies.

“All dealers are now ‘getting a stomach ache’ because no one is buying (electric motorcycles). Buyers are waiting for when new incentives will appear,” said Moeldoko, Chairman of Periklindo at the Kadin ESDM and Katadata Energy Insight Forum some time ago.

This incentive turmoil makes it difficult for dealers to attract buyers, ultimately leading to layoffs (Termination of Employment) at the related outlets.

Moeldoko emphasized that the government's initiative to support the acceleration of electrification is already quite good. 

Such as Presidential Instruction (Inpres) Number 7 of 2022, which requires government official vehicles to use electric cars.

“A very good situation for the business world, there is a clear umbrella. However, the policies below it still need to be improved,” he asserted.

For the acceleration of electrification to run well, he believes the government needs to provide certainty, especially for business actors.

“We currently have no certainty. So let's pursue all of that,” he asserted.

For your information, the Rp 7 million electric motorcycle subsidy program is rumored to be continuing.

However, the certainty will only be announced on June 5, 2025, coinciding with the launch of an incentive package to boost economic growth.

The incentive package includes several things such as discounts in the transportation sector for two months to a 20 percent toll tariff discount for 110 million motorists passing through during the school holiday period.

In addition, there is also an increase in social assistance for basic food cards and BSU (Wage Subsidy Assistance), as well as a 50 percent discount on JKK (Work Accident Insurance) contributions for workers in labor-intensive sectors.
